Just hours after Deadline reported that Joseph Gordon-Levitt was in talks to produce, direct, and star in an adaptation of DC ComicsSandman at Warner Brothers, the star took to Twitter to confirm his involvement. Check out his tweet below.

Ladies and gentlemen, I'm incredibly honored to be working with David Goyer, Warner Bros, and @neilhimself on SANDMAN. #Prelude

Other than the big news that he confirmed here, the tweet is interesting for two reasons. First, apparently Neil Gaiman, the creator of the Sandman comic, will be involved in the project in some way (remember, they’re still looking for a writer). The second item to note is the #Prelude hashtag that Gordon-Levitt uses. This could be an indication that the movie will be based on Gaiman’s "Preludes & Nocturnes" storyline, which served as the debut tale for the character in 1989. 

While this tweet answered many questions, it raised plenty more. We’ll have more on Sandman as it becomes available.
